Anything created by man should be considered art

Recently, while I was browsing the Internet I came across a video on YouTube titled “Modern Art Sucks”. In the video, there is a guy talking about how modern art is stupid and that is should not be considered art. He also talks about how anything that he could recreate is not art, and how artists are famous for stupid works like splattered paint on a canvas. But this is an extremely narrow view of art. Art should be defined as anything created by a human and brought the real world.

It is understandable that one could have discontent toward an artist who creates something they find ridiculous and that the artist makes money for it. For example, someone who defines him or herself as an artist could create something simple and sell it as modern art to get money. However, that person may see that work as nothing but money, but the fact that they created it from their mind makes it art. It is unique to itself down to the slightest of details, and can never be made the same way ever again.

In the Oxford dictionary, art is defined as, “The expression or application of human creative skill and imagination.” This is more than true when relating to anything that mankind has created in the history of the world.

Any kind of creation should be defined as art, whether it be a detailed sculpture or an advertisement for a billboard. Someone took the time, as small of an amount as it may be, to create something to view or hear for any sort of reason. One could simply be bored and make a stick figure; art is created there. A piece of work does not have to appeal to an audience. It can even not be appealing to the creator themselves. But the fact that they took the time to picture the figure in their head and draw it on a piece of paper says something.

However there are those who believe nothing is art. The cultural movement Dadaism would aspire to such views. They believe in a pessimistic view in which anything achieved and created by man is useless. But when creating art, we are literally plucking ideas from our imagination and bringing them to the real world. Such an incredible achievement is what indefinitely separates us from animals. What makes us different can be defined by one sentence: “I see with eyes, think with words, then I am a human being.” But when one sees more with their eyes and thinks better with words, than they are able to use their creative abilities to their full extent and become artists.These qualities are what really make humans so different.

No single person has to consider something art, but when one does have an open mind to the idea of art being anything that is created, then one can look at the world in a different, enlightened view. There are many things we take for granted that can be looked at as art. For example, the font being used to type this document is a form of art. Someone took the time to design an appealing, concise, and clear alphabet.

One of the oldest and most looked over works of art is language. It simply was someone thinking and using different sounds to help communicate with others. Then when its use was found practical, it caught on rapidly and changed into varieties of the original.

Even if something created may be unappealing or effortlessly made, one should think about what it is in terms of art. Whatever the creation might be, it was thought of and made into reality from that thought. The next invention, portrait, sculpture, song, home appliance, and so on will have been made originally in the mind of a person. Imagination is forever and art is a gateway between our mind and reality. We will never stop creating art.
